Makalamabedi clinic nearly complete

22 Feb 2022

Makalamabedi clinic, a donation of Leseding Interiors, is expected to be completed by end of this month.
Briefing Boteti Sub-council session in Letlhakane on Thursday, senior district officer for development, Ms Patience Fanikiso stated that all internal works had been completed, save for power inspection.
She indicated that the plot for six staff houses had also been secured.
Ms Fanikiso also stated the contractor of special classrooms at Tsienyane Primary School in Rakops had handed the project to Debswana mining company.
The project, which began in October 2020, was donated by Debswana at a contract sum of P4.75 million.
She noted that the classrooms were, however, awaiting procurement of suitable furniture appropriate for special need children.
In addition, Ms Fanikiso indicated that upgrading of Kedia Health Post to level one clinic, donor-funded by Crown Holdings through their community social responsibility initiative, had been fenced and the contractor was already on site.
She further informed the sub-council that construction of Mopipi Clinic with maternity wing by World Group of Companies had not yet commenced.
Plans, she said, had been approved by the Ministry of Health and transferred to Boteti Sub-council for approval.
Ms Fanikiso indicated that water and electricity connection payments had been done to pave way for the smooth take off of the project.
She indicated that relocation of Mosu Health Post donated by Landmark was ongoing.
Application for separation of water and power meters was approved and plans to donate beds to beneficiaries within the catchment area were afoot.
Ms Fanikiso also indicated that maintenance of Letlhakane Abattoir was ongoing, stating that phase one of the project was on defects and liability stage until April.
She stated that phase two of the project commenced in November 2021, and was expected to be completed by end of this month.
The second phase included installation of the splitting saw, internal and external painting of the structure as well as expansion of the kraals, among other things.
All internal works, she said, had been completed. Pending works, she said, included construction of a new slope and opening of a new truck access gate. ENDS
